What is Self-Love?
Self-love isn't about being narcissistic or thinking you're better than everyone else. It's about recognizing your inherent worth as a human being. It's the unconditional acceptance and appreciation of yourself, flaws and all. Think of it as the foundation upon which you build a happy, healthy, and fulfilling life. Without a solid base of self-love, it's easy to fall into patterns of self-criticism, doubt, and negativity.
Self-love involves several key components. First, it's about self-awareness – truly understanding your strengths, weaknesses, values, and beliefs. It’s about acknowledging your emotions without judgment and understanding why you feel the way you do. Second, it’s about self-acceptance. This means embracing all aspects of yourself, even the parts you might not like so much. We all have imperfections, and that's what makes us human. Self-acceptance is about recognizing that you are worthy of love and respect, just as you are. Third, self-compassion is a vital ingredient. This involves treating yourself with the same kindness and understanding you would offer a friend. When you make a mistake or face a challenge, self-compassion encourages you to be gentle with yourself, rather than beating yourself up. Fourth, self-care is a tangible expression of self-love. This includes taking care of your physical, emotional, and mental well-being through activities that nourish you, such as exercise, healthy eating, relaxation, and pursuing your passions. Finally, self-love is about setting boundaries that protect your well-being. It's about saying no to things that drain you or compromise your values and surrounding yourself with people who support and uplift you. In essence, self-love is a continuous practice of treating yourself with kindness, respect, and understanding, just as you would treat someone you deeply care about. It's the recognition that you are worthy of your own love and attention, and it's the foundation for a happy and fulfilling life.
Why is Self-Love Important?
So, why is self-love so important? Well, guys, the benefits are immense and far-reaching. Let's break down some of the key reasons why cultivating self-love is essential for your overall well-being.
First and foremost, self-love boosts your mental health. When you love yourself, you're less likely to engage in negative self-talk or fall into patterns of self-criticism. You develop a stronger sense of self-worth, which acts as a buffer against stress, anxiety, and depression. Loving yourself allows you to approach challenges with resilience and optimism, knowing that you have the inner strength to cope. It also helps you to recognize your value, leading to increased confidence and self-esteem. When you believe in yourself and your abilities, you're more likely to pursue your goals and take positive risks, knowing that you deserve success and happiness. Moreover, self-love fosters emotional stability. When you have a strong foundation of self-acceptance, you're better equipped to handle difficult emotions. You're less likely to be overwhelmed by setbacks or rejections, as you understand that these are temporary experiences and don't diminish your worth. This emotional resilience is crucial for navigating the ups and downs of life with grace and poise. Furthermore, self-love reduces the need for external validation. When you genuinely love and accept yourself, you're less reliant on the opinions of others to feel good about yourself. You're able to make decisions based on your own values and needs, rather than seeking approval from external sources. This independence allows you to live more authentically and pursue your passions without fear of judgment. In summary, self-love is a cornerstone of mental well-being. It enhances your self-esteem, builds emotional resilience, and reduces the impact of negative emotions and external pressures, leading to a more balanced and fulfilling mental state.
